Job Description

Job description:

We are looking for a Corporate Senior Financial Analyst to join a growing Corporate Finance team in Ontario, CA. This is an exciting opportunity to play a key role in shaping financial strategy and decision-making for a dynamic, fast-growing organization at the forefront of real estate development and construction.

What Youll Do

  • Lead and support corporate financial planning, budgeting, and forecasting, providing insights that drive strategic decisions.
  • Perform variance and profitability analysis across diverse real estate and construction projects.
  • Develop detailed financial models for acquisitions, investments, and new developments.
  • Prepare and present executive-level reports and performance dashboards for senior leadership.
  • Collaborate closely with accounting, project management, and operations to ensure accuracy and alignment in financial reporting.
  • Assist in strategic planning initiatives, helping to shape the companys growth trajectory.
  • Continuously improve financial processes and reporting tools to enhance efficiency and data integrity.

Qualifications:

What Youll Bring

  • Education: Bachelors deg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ics, or a related field (MBA or CPA preferred).
  • Experience: 5+ years in corporate finance, FP&A, or real estate/construction finance.
  • Technical Skills: Advanced Excel and financial modeling capabilities; experience with ERP and reporting systems.
  • Knowledge: Strong understanding of real estate development, project costing, and financial performance metrics.
  • Soft Skills: Excellent analytical, organizational, and communication skills, with a proactive and collaborative mindset.
